Although the easiest way to get arrows is by trading with a fletcher, but the crafting recipe for arrows can see more use if arrows can be crafted in large quantities at a cheaper cost.
Since I don't find it making sense or balanced to destroy a whole block of gravel for only a single flint and killing a chicken to get a maximum of about only 5 feathers (looting enchantment), my solution is to increase the number of flint yielded by one block of gravel to about 4 to 8 and the number of feathers yielded by killing a chicken (with no enchantments) to 2 to 5. Although this would also make flint and steel and book-and-quill's relatively cheaper to make, the impact is minimal to make crafted arrows obtainable in greater quantities.
